Technical Field
The utility model belongs to the technical field of connecting components, and particularly relates to a novel clamping type handle assembly.
Background
In both life and production operations, some clamping structures, such as a connection structure between a mobile phone and a mobile phone support or a connection structure between a photographic device and a holder, are often encountered.
In the prior art, a typical clamping structure generally comprises two parts, one part is a clamping structure main body, the other part is a movable structure movably mounted on the clamping structure main body, and the movable structure and the clamping structure main body are very easy to shake due to a fit clearance, so that the connection reliability of the clamping structure is reduced.

The utility model provides a novel clamping type handle component, which comprises the following components:
1. base 1
The base 1 is the main structure of the novel clamping type handle assembly, and the base 1 is used for fixedly mounting the buckle 4 (the buckle 4 is another composition structure of the utility model and is used for being arranged on a product to be fixed, so that the product to be fixed can be quickly assembled on the base 1). Be provided with a draw-in groove slide 2 on the base 1, draw-in groove slide 2 is linear type spout structure, and draw-in groove slide 2 is used for assembling buckle 4.
Specifically, the slot slideway 2 is a linear chute structure, and the slot slideway 2 comprises a bottom surface and two side edges. In a preferred embodiment of the utility model, the bottom surface and the two side edges are of planar configuration. In other preferred embodiments of the present invention, the bottom surface and the two side edges may adopt a sawtooth surface structure, a wave surface structure, or a matte surface structure, and when the sawtooth surface structure and the wave surface structure are adopted, the moving and positioning of the buckle 4 may be realized, and at the same time, the firmness of the buckle 4 in the slot slideway 2 may be improved, and when the matte surface structure is adopted, the firmness of the buckle 4 in the slot slideway 2 may be improved.
For the purpose of structural description, defined herein are: along the length direction of the clamping groove slideway 2, one side edge of the clamping groove slideway 2 is a fixed edge (the fixed edge can also be understood as a 'face' structure forming the clamping groove slideway 2), the fixed edge is an inclined surface structure inclining towards the long central line direction of the clamping groove slideway 2, and the inclination angle (the included angle between the fixed edge and the vertical plane) of the fixed edge is between 5 degrees and 10 degrees. The other side of the clamping groove slideway 2 is provided with a movable block 3, the movable block 3 can move towards the direction of the fixed edge, the side surface of the movable block 3 towards the fixed edge is a movable edge, the movable edge is an inclined surface structure inclined towards the direction of the long central line of the clamping groove slideway 2, and the movable edge can also be understood as a 'surface' structure forming the clamping groove slideway 2 on the movable block 3. The inclination angle of the movable edge (the included angle between the movable edge and the vertical plane) is between 5 degrees and 10 degrees, and further, the inclination angle of the movable edge is consistent with that of the fixed edge.
The movable block 3 is arranged on the base 1 to form a clamping groove slideway 2 which has adjustable width and a trapezoidal cross section. Specifically, the bottom surface and the two side edges of the card slot slide 2 can form a slot structure having an opening, and the width of the card slot slide 2 is gradually reduced from the bottom surface of the card slot slide 2 toward the opening direction.
In an embodiment of the present invention, the base 1 is designed in a split structure, and specifically includes a base main body 11 and a base support portion 12, the base support portion 12 is movable relative to the base main body 11 along a length direction of the card slot slideway 2, and the base support portion 12 is fixedly disposed on the base main body 11 by a bolt. There is a part of draw-in groove slide 2 (for example the anterior segment of draw-in groove slide 2) on base main part 11, has another part of draw-in groove slide 2 (for example the back end of draw-in groove slide 2) on base branch portion 12, can constitute a complete draw-in groove slide 2 after base main part 11 is assembled with base branch portion 12. Of course, when the base 1 adopts the above-mentioned split structure, the card slot slideway 2 may be only arranged on the base main body 11 or the base support part 12. In another embodiment of the present invention, the base 1 may also be designed as a one-piece structure.
In the embodiment that the base 1 adopts the split type structural design (the base 1 comprises a base main body 11 and a base support part 12), the base support part 12 is provided with a support part straight round hole (the support part straight round hole is of a straight round hole structure with the same diameter), the axis of the support part straight round hole is vertical to the length direction of the clamping groove slide way 2 (in the vertical arrangement state of the base, the support part straight round hole is positioned below the clamping groove slide way 2), and the base 1 can be assembled on a rod-shaped structure by arranging the support part straight round hole on the base support part 12, so that the purpose of increasing the fixing mode of the utility model is achieved. The base support part 12 can be installed on the base main body 11 by adopting a bolt fixing mode, namely, after the base support part 12 is butted with the base main body 11, the base support part can be fixedly connected with the base main body 11 through bolts. Specifically, the base support part 12 is provided with a support part spring hole, the base main body 11 is provided with a spring pressing rod, the support part spring hole is internally provided with a second spring, one end of the second spring is abutted against the bottom of the support part spring hole, and the other end of the second spring can be abutted against the other end of the spring pressing rod, so that elastic pre-tightening force is applied to the installation of the base support part 12 on the base main body 11. Set up the second spring between base branch portion 12 and base main part 11, exert the condition that elasticity pretightning force can avoid the bolt not hard up to appear through the second spring.
In the present invention, the base 1 is preferably made of plastic, and when the base 1 is a split structure, the structures constituting the base 1 are made of the same material.
Therefore, the movable block 3 is arranged on the base 1, so that the width of the clamping groove slideway 2 can be adjusted, and the buckle 4 can be conveniently disassembled and clamped.
Specifically, the connection structure between the movable block 3 and the base 1 is as follows: be provided with movable block straight hole (movable block straight hole is long straight round hole structure) on movable block 3, the axis in movable block straight hole is perpendicular with the length direction of draw-in groove slide 2, it is provided with fastening bolt 6 with base 1 screw-thread fit to pass movable block straight hole (fastening bolt 6's one end inserts in movable block straight hole and with base 1 screw-thread fit, fastening bolt 6's the other end is provided with the turn button, thereby make things convenient for fastening bolt 6's rotation), movable block 3 sets up on base 1 and the accessible is screwed up fastening bolt 6 and is pressed from both sides the clamp buckle 4 through fastening bolt 6.
Furthermore, the base 1 is provided with a spring mounting hole, a first spring is arranged in the spring mounting hole, one end of the first spring is abutted against the bottom of the spring mounting hole, and the other end of the first spring is abutted against the movable block 3 and is used for applying elastic pre-tightening force to the movable block 3 in the direction opposite to the long central line of the clamping groove slide way 2. In this embodiment, by providing the first spring, a reverse elastic pre-tightening force can be applied to tighten the movable block 3, so that the loose of the movable block 3 can be reduced.
Still further, the straight hole of the movable block is arranged through the centroid of the movable block 3, so that the movable block 3 can be prevented from loosening due to unbalanced stress. Two spring mounting holes are arranged and are symmetrically arranged on the base 1 relative to the straight hole of the movable block.
2. And (4) a buckle.
The buckle 4 is used for being mounted on a product to be fixed, and is fixed on the product to be fixed through a bolt.
The buckle 4 is an independent component, and the buckle 4 is detachably assembled in the card slot slideway 2.
The buckle 4 is in a regular polygon structure, an even number of side faces are arranged on the buckle 4, and each side face can be abutted against the movable edge or the fixed edge.
When buckle 4 assembles in draw-in groove slide 2, buckle 4's bottom surface can offset with draw-in groove slide 2's bottom surface, buckle 4 goes up relative both sides face for the card dress face (when buckle 4 is regular polygon structure, arbitrary two relative sides all can regard as the card dress face, when buckle 4 installs and treats fixed product like this, treat that fixed product rotates the realization angular adjustment back, still can be fixed to base 1 through buckle 4), the card dress face is the inclined plane structure with fixed limit and movable limit adaptation, the card dress face can offset with fixed limit and movable limit. When the inclination angles of the movable side and the fixed side are kept consistent, the inclination angles of the side surfaces of the buckle 4 are also kept consistent.
3. A handle 5.
The handle 5 is a structure for holding by hand. The handle 5 is connected with the base 1, and can be fixedly connected or hinged.
Specifically, the top end of the handle 5 is provided with a hinge platform, the bottom of the base 1 (the bottom of the base main body 11) is provided with a hinge plane, and a hinge fastening bolt 6 is arranged after the hinge plane is abutted against the hinge platform, so that the base 1 is hinged with the handle 5. The installation angle of the base 1 on the handle 5 can be adjusted by adopting a hinged connection structure between the base 1 and the handle 5. The utility model can also optimize the structure of the hinging table and the hinging plane to ensure that the contact surface of the hinging table and the hinging plane is a sawtooth surface or a wavy surface, thus positioning the rotation of the base 1.
The handle 5 can adopt plastic materials to make, and handle 5 adopts hollow handle structural design, and the top of handle 5 is articulated with base 1, and the side of handle 5 is provided with the handle round hole near the position of playing the other end, and the axis of handle round hole is perpendicular with the length direction of draw-in groove slide 2. A handle bolt 7 is arranged on the handle 5, the axis of the handle bolt 7 is perpendicular to the axis of the handle round hole, and the end part of the handle bolt 7 penetrates through the handle 5 and can be inserted into the handle round hole.
According to the utility model, the silica gel layer can be arranged on the outer side of the handle 5, so that the comfort of holding the handle 5 is improved. The utility model can also arrange a flexible layer on the buckle 4, the fixed edge or the movable edge, thereby realizing flexible contact between the buckle 4 and the base 1.
